Arsenal vs. Manchester City: Premier League betting odds, preview, and pick

Manchester City have an eight-point lead at the top of the Premier League table as we kick off 2022, and Pep Guardiola’s men are red-hot favorites to win another league crown. Arsenal will be hoping they can upset the odds at home, however, and continue their purple patch in December, which saw them jump to fourth in the race for the last Champions League spot.

The stakes couldn’t be higher as we get set for a thriller in North London.

Same old story for in-form Arsenal?

Mike Arteta’s side are in a lovely bit of from, winning their last four games on the spin and scoring 14 goals (3.5 per game), while conceding just the once (0.25 goals per game). In the last eight league games, only Liverpool and Manchester City have picked up more points per game than Arsenal, who have not only climbed up to fourth, but put four points between themselves and West Ham in fifth.

It’s been a remarkable turnaround for the Gunners, who were rock bottom after losing their opening three games, and their good run has been built on beating lower-quality teams. Against bottom-five teams, they have a 6-0-0 record, and against bottom-10 teams, it’s still a solid 8-1-2.

The problem comes against the top teams. Against the top 10, Arsenal’s record reads 3-4-1, and this season they’ve already lost 5-0 away to Manchester City, 4-0 away to Liverpool, and 2-0 at home to Chelsea.

Unfortunately, that’s just the norm for Arsenal fans, who have watched their team struggle against the top sides consistently over the last decade. In their last 12 league games with Manchester City, the Gunners have a 0-10-2 record, with their last victory against them coming in December 2015.

There are reasons to be optimistic this time around. In the last 10 Arsenal games, young English duo Emile Smith Rowe and Bukayo Saka have a combined 11 goals, while keeper Aaron Ramsdale has an 81.8% save success percentage (third in the league) and kept clean sheets in 56.3% of his games (second in the league). All three players are under 23, so they won’t have the scar tissue of regular beatings from Manchester City.

Can they start turning the tide?

Dominant City move closer to the title

When Manchester City lost 2-0 at home to Crystal Palace, it was fitting that the game landed on Halloween because since then their form has been scary good! After that surprise defeat, Guardiola’s men have now won 10 games on the bounce, scoring 31 goals (3.1 a game) and keeping six clean sheets (60%).

It’s a run of form that has not only thrust Manchester City to the top of the table, but they have opened an eight-point gap to the rest of the chasing pack. In two months, they have dealt a defining, dominant blow to their title rivals and are now heavy favorites to retain their crown.

No team in the league has scored as many goals as City (51), conceded as few (12), or kept as many clean sheets (15). City won the league with 86 points last year, finishing 12 clear of the rest, and this year they’re on track for an even better return, averaging 2.5 points a game, which would put them on 95 in May.

Being on the road doesn’t matter to City, who have an 8-1-1 record away from home this season and have averaged two goals a game, while keeping five clean sheets. Their record against Arsenal has been almost flawless, and it took them just 12 minutes to go 2-0 up against the Gunners earlier this season, eventually thrashing them 5-0.

Arsenal and Manchester City betting trends

  • There have been Over 2.5 goals in five of Arsenal’s last six league games
  • Arsenal have failed to score just once in their last 12 league games
  • Manchester City have kept six clean sheets in the last 10 league games
  • Arsenal have failed to score in seven of the last eight league games against Manchester City
  • There have been Over 2.5 goals in seven of Manchester City’s last nine league games
  • 73% of the last 15 league meetings between Arsenal and Manchester City have had Over 2.5 goals

New year, same City

It’s hard to see anyone stopping Manchester City in this run of form, and despite Arsenal’s winning stretch, City have owned the Gunners in the last six years, and that won’t change this weekend.

Arsenal have struggled to land any sort of blow on City in recent meetings, and Guardiola’s side have been swiftly putting teams to the sword this season — leading at half-time in nine of their last 10 games.

It would be no surprise to see them take an early lead at the Emirates and put the game to bed before the teams go in at half-time. Raheem Sterling has opened the scoring in three of the last four meetings between these teams and can get City off to the perfect start again.  

Score prediction: Arsenal 0-3 Manchester City (+1000)

Arsenal vs. Manchester City: Manchester City to win to nil (+190)

Same Game Combo: Manchester City to win, Under 3.5 total goals, Raheem Sterling to score first (+1150)
